Mob Programming: Trabajo en equipo para aumentar la productividad

¡Bienvenidos a mi blog, queridos lectores! En esta ocasión quiero hablarles sobre una técnica que ha ganado popularidad en los últimos años en el mundo del desarrollo de software: Mob Programming. Se trata de una metodología colaborativa donde todo un equipo trabaja en conjunto en un mismo proyecto, compartiendo ideas y habilidades para lograr un mejor resultado. Si quieres saber más sobre cómo esta técnica puede mejorar la productividad y el ambiente laboral, ¡sigue leyendo!

La productividad y la motivación laboral son factores clave en el éxito de cualquier empresa. Cuando los trabajadores se sienten motivados, su rendimiento aumenta y, por lo tanto, también lo hace la productividad de la empresa.

Es importante tener en cuenta que la motivación no es algo que se pueda comprar o imponer. La empresa debe trabajar en crear un ambiente de trabajo en el que los empleados se sientan valorados y en el que puedan desarrollarse personal y profesionalmente.

Una forma de lograr esto es a través de la comunicación y el feedback constante. Es importante que los trabajadores sepan qué se espera de ellos y que tengan la oportunidad de expresar sus preocupaciones y sugerencias.

Otro aspecto importante es el reconocimiento del trabajo bien hecho. Cuando los empleados sienten que su esfuerzo es reconocido, se sienten más motivados para seguir trabajando duro.

En resumen, la motivación laboral es un elemento fundamental para mejorar la productividad de una empresa. Es necesario crear un ambiente de trabajo positivo, comunicativo y que reconozca el trabajo bien hecho.

CONTENIDOS

Mob Programming: A Whole Team Approach • Woody Zuill • GOTO 2017

¿Cuáles son los beneficios de la programación en grupo (mob programming)?

La programación en grupo o mob programming es una técnica cada vez más utilizada en entornos laborales que buscan mejorar su productividad y motivación de los trabajadores. Esta técnica consiste en que un grupo de personas trabaje en el mismo proyecto al mismo tiempo, utilizando un solo ordenador.

Entre los beneficios de la programación en grupo destacan:

1. Mejora la calidad del código: Al trabajar en equipo, se pueden detectar errores más fácilmente y se puede discutir la mejor manera de solucionarlos. Además, al compartir conocimientos y habilidades, se puede mejorar la calidad del código final.

2. Aumenta la eficiencia: Al trabajar juntos en el mismo proyecto, se pueden dividir las tareas según las habilidades y conocimientos de cada miembro del equipo, lo que permite realizar el trabajo de manera más rápida.

3. Promueve el trabajo en equipo: La programación en grupo fomenta la colaboración entre los miembros del equipo y promueve una cultura de trabajo en equipo.

4. Reduce el estrés: Al trabajar en equipo, se comparte la responsabilidad del proyecto y esto puede reducir la carga de trabajo individual y, por ende, el nivel de estrés.

5. Fomenta la creatividad: Al trabajar en equipo, se pueden generar ideas más innovadoras para abordar los problemas y retos del proyecto.

En resumen, la programación en grupo es una técnica que puede ayudar a mejorar la productividad y motivación laboral, así como la calidad del proyecto final. Es importante mencionar que para implementar esta técnica es necesario tener un equipo de trabajo colaborativo y comprometido con los objetivos del proyecto.

¿Cuáles son los roles en la programación en grupo (mob programming)?

La programación en grupo o mob programming es una técnica cada vez más utilizada en entornos laborales que buscan mejorar su productividad y motivación de los trabajadores. Esta técnica consiste en que un grupo de personas trabaje en el mismo proyecto al mismo tiempo, utilizando un solo ordenador.

Entre los beneficios de la programación en grupo destacan:

1. Mejora la calidad del código: Al trabajar en equipo, se pueden detectar errores más fácilmente y se puede discutir la mejor manera de solucionarlos. Además, al compartir conocimientos y habilidades, se puede mejorar la calidad del código final.

2. Aumenta la eficiencia: Al trabajar juntos en el mismo proyecto, se pueden dividir las tareas según las habilidades y conocimientos de cada miembro del equipo, lo que permite realizar el trabajo de manera más rápida.

3. Promueve el trabajo en equipo: La programación en grupo fomenta la colaboración entre los miembros del equipo y promueve una cultura de trabajo en equipo.

4. Reduce el estrés: Al trabajar en equipo, se comparte la responsabilidad del proyecto y esto puede reducir la carga de trabajo individual y, por ende, el nivel de estrés.

5. Fomenta la creatividad: Al trabajar en equipo, se pueden generar ideas más innovadoras para abordar los problemas y retos del proyecto.

En resumen, la programación en grupo es una técnica que puede ayudar a mejorar la productividad y motivación laboral, así como la calidad del proyecto final. Es importante mencionar que para implementar esta técnica es necesario tener un equipo de trabajo colaborativo y comprometido con los objetivos del proyecto.

¿Qué es el entrenamiento en grupo?

El entrenamiento en grupo es una técnica de desarrollo personal y profesional que se enfoca en mejorar la productividad y motivación laboral, al mismo tiempo que fomenta la colaboración y el trabajo en equipo. Esta técnica consiste en reunir a un grupo de personas con objetivos similares, para que trabajen juntas en un ambiente de apoyo y aprendizaje mutuo.

Durante el entrenamiento en grupo se realizan diversas actividades, tales como charlas, discusiones y dinámicas, que buscan identificar los obstáculos que impiden el progreso individual y grupal, así como también generar soluciones y estrategias efectivas para superarlos. De esta manera, se logra un aumento en la motivación y rendimiento laboral, lo que a su vez se traduce en un ambiente laboral más positivo y productivo.

Además, el entrenamiento en grupo permite que los participantes se den cuenta de que no están solos en sus desafíos y que pueden contar con el apoyo del equipo. Asimismo, se crean vínculos de confianza y se fomenta la convivencia y la comunicación efectiva, lo que a su vez mejora la dinámica y el clima laboral.

En resumen, el entrenamiento en grupo es una herramienta útil para fomentar la productividad y la motivación laboral, además de mejorar la colaboración y el trabajo en equipo, generando un ambiente laboral más positivo y eficiente.

¿Qué es un proyecto en grupo?

Un proyecto en grupo es una tarea o actividad que se lleva a cabo por un equipo de trabajo con el fin de lograr un objetivo común. En este tipo de proyectos, cada miembro del equipo aporta sus habilidades y conocimientos para alcanzar la meta establecida. Es fundamental que exista una buena comunicación y colaboración entre los integrantes del equipo para poder cumplir con los plazos establecidos y obtener resultados exitosos. En este sentido, es importante destacar la importancia de contar con un líder fuerte y motivador que pueda impulsar y dirigir al equipo en cada etapa del proyecto. La colaboración en un proyecto en grupo puede ser muy beneficioso para mejorar la productividad y motivación laboral de los empleados implicados, ya que les permite trabajar en un ambiente colaborativo y fomenta la creatividad y el trabajo en equipo.

Preguntas más frecuentes

¿Cómo puede el Mob Programming mejorar la comunicación y el trabajo en equipo dentro del entorno laboral para aumentar la productividad?

El Mob Programming es una técnica de desarrollo de software en la que todo el equipo trabaja en una sola tarea al mismo tiempo, utilizando solamente una computadora y compartiendo el mismo espacio físico. Esta metodología se ha demostrado efectiva para mejorar la comunicación, el trabajo en equipo y, por ende, aumentar la productividad.

En primer lugar, el Mob Programming fomenta la comunicación constante entre todos los miembros del equipo, lo que ayuda a evitar malentendidos y confusiones, y permite que cada uno tenga una visión más completa del proyecto. Esto mejora la calidad del trabajo y evita errores que pueden retrasar el proyecto.

En segundo lugar, la técnica del Mob Programming permite que todos los miembros del equipo tengan un conocimiento profundo del proyecto y estén involucrados en todas las etapas del desarrollo. Esto no solo aumenta la motivación de los empleados, sino que también fomenta el trabajo en equipo y la colaboración constante, lo que puede llevar a mejores soluciones y resultados.

Por último, el Mob Programming es especialmente útil para resolver problemas complejos de manera rápida y eficiente. Todos los miembros del equipo aportan sus conocimientos y experiencia, y trabajan juntos en la solución del problema. Esto no solo aumenta la productividad y la eficiencia, sino que también mejora la calidad del trabajo y aumenta la satisfacción del cliente.

En resumen, el Mob Programming es una técnica muy efectiva para mejorar la comunicación y el trabajo en equipo en el entorno laboral, lo que puede llevar a una mayor productividad y motivación de los empleados. Si se implementa adecuadamente, esta metodología puede ser una gran herramienta para cualquier equipo de trabajo que busque mejorar su rendimiento y la calidad de su trabajo.

¿De qué manera se puede motivar al equipo a involucrarse en el Mob Programming y cómo impacta esto en la productividad y calidad del trabajo?

Mob Programming es una técnica que consiste en trabajar en equipo, con todos los miembros del equipo programando al mismo tiempo en la misma computadora. Para motivar al equipo a involucrarse en el Mob Programming, es importante resaltar los beneficios que esto trae.

En primer lugar, el Mob Programming permite resolver problemas más rápido y con mayor eficacia. Al trabajar en conjunto, se pueden identificar rápidamente los errores y se pueden encontrar soluciones más creativas e innovadoras. Además, se ofrece la oportunidad de compartir conocimientos y habilidades, lo que mejora la capacidad del equipo para resolver problemas.

En segundo lugar, el Mob Programming fomenta el trabajo en equipo y la colaboración. Al trabajar juntos en un proyecto, se crea un ambiente de confianza y se fortalecen las relaciones entre los miembros del equipo. Esto puede llevar a un aumento de la confianza, la comunicación y la motivación.

Por último, el Mob Programming permite mejorar la calidad del trabajo. Al trabajar en equipo, se pueden detectar más fácilmente los errores y se pueden hacer correcciones antes de que sea demasiado tarde. Además, se asegura que todos los miembros del equipo comparten la misma visión del proyecto y trabajan en conjunto para lograr los mismos objetivos.

En conclusión, el Mob Programming puede ser una gran herramienta para aumentar la productividad y motivación laboral del equipo. Al destacar los beneficios de esta técnica y fomentar la colaboración y el trabajo en equipo, se puede incentivar a los miembros del equipo a involucrarse en esta metodología y mejorar la calidad del trabajo en equipo.

¿Cuáles son los principales desafíos que enfrentan las empresas al implementar el Mob Programming en cuanto a la gestión de recursos humanos y cómo pueden superarlos para mejorar la productividad?

Mob Programming es una técnica colaborativa en la que varias personas trabajan juntas en el mismo equipo. Aunque puede ser muy efectivo para mejorar la productividad, también presenta desafíos para la gestión de recursos humanos.

Uno de los mayores desafíos es asegurarse de que cada miembro del equipo tenga la oportunidad de contribuir y participar plenamente en el proceso. Esto puede requerir un líder fuerte que pueda mantener el ritmo y la dirección del equipo, al mismo tiempo que asegura que todos los miembros tengan la oportunidad de aportar su experiencia y habilidades.

Otro desafío es garantizar que todos los miembros del equipo tengan un nivel similar de experiencia y habilidades técnicas. Si algunos miembros tienen más experiencia o conocimientos que otros, pueden dominar la discusión y la toma de decisiones, lo que puede llevar a la exclusión de otros miembros del equipo.

Para superar estos desafíos, las empresas deben enfocarse en la formación y capacitación de todos los miembros del equipo. Esto puede incluir la realización de sesiones de capacitación para garantizar que todos los miembros del equipo tengan una comprensión común de los objetivos y las expectativas del proyecto, así como la adquisición de habilidades técnicas necesarias para realizar el trabajo.

También es importante proporcionar una comunicación abierta y transparente entre los miembros del equipo, a fin de que puedan compartir sus ideas, preocupaciones y contribuciones de manera efectiva. Esto puede ayudar a garantizar que todos los miembros del equipo se sientan valorados y apoyados en el proceso de trabajo conjunto.

En resumen, para implementar con éxito el Mob Programming y mejorar la productividad, las empresas deben enfocarse en la formación y capacitación de los miembros del equipo, la comunicación efectiva, y garantizar que todos tengan la oportunidad de contribuir plenamente al proyecto.